Bunni DEX Shuts Down Following $8.4M Exploit: A Deep Dive into the Demise of a DeFi Innovator

Introduction: The End of the Road for Bunni DEX

In a significant blow to the decentralized finance (DeFi) sector, Bunni, a decentralized exchange renowned for its advanced liquidity mechanisms, has officially ceased operations. The decision, announced on October 23 via the project's official X account, comes in the wake of a devastating September exploit that drained approximately $8.4 million in user funds. The team cited the financial and operational impossibility of a secure relaunch as the primary reason for the closure, marking a somber end for one of the most technically ambitious projects built on Uniswap (UNI) V4 hooks. The September Exploit: A Detailed Breakdown of the $8.4M Attack

The incident that precipitated Bunni's downfall occurred in early September. Attackers targeted the project's primary smart contracts on Ethereum (ETH) and Unichain, exploiting a specific vulnerability within its Liquidity Distribution Function (LDF). This feature was a core innovation of Bunni, designed to optimize returns for liquidity providers.

The exploit was executed through a combination of flash loan manipulation and the exploitation of rounding errors within the LDF's code. This sophisticated method allowed the attackers to withdraw significantly more assets than they were entitled to, ultimately leading to the loss of roughly $8.4 million, predominantly in the stablecoins USDC and USDT. The Bunni team acted swiftly to freeze contract operations once the attack was detected, preventing further losses. A 10% bounty was offered to the attacker for the return of the funds, but no response was ever received.

Audits and Oversight: The Challenge of Identifying Logic-Level Flaws

A critical aspect of this exploit is that Bunni's smart contracts had undergone security audits by two highly respected firms in the space, Trail of Bits and Cyfrin. Despite these preemptive measures, the vulnerability was not caught. The bug was later classified as a "logic-level flaw" rather than a simple implementation error.

This distinction is crucial for understanding DeFi security. An implementation error might involve a coding mistake, such as an incorrect variable or a faulty loop. A logic-level flaw, however, exists at the design stage; the code executes exactly as written, but the underlying economic or logical model contains a flaw that can be manipulated. This type of vulnerability is notoriously difficult to identify in audits, as it requires auditors to not only check for code correctness but also to anticipate novel attack vectors on entirely new financial primitives, like Bunni's LDF.

The Aftermath: Plummeting TVL and Stalled Development

The immediate impact of the exploit was catastrophic for Bunni's ecosystem. Prior to the September incident, Bunni had built a robust presence in DeFi, with a Total Value Locked (TVL) exceeding $60 million. This metric is a key indicator of health and user trust in DeFi protocols.

Following the hack, user confidence evaporated. The TVL plummeted from its peak to near zero as liquidity providers rushed to withdraw their remaining assets. Concurrently, all trading activity and development work on the platform ground to a complete halt. The project lost its momentum and, critically, its revenue stream, leaving it without the financial resources needed to navigate a recovery.

The Inevitable Shutdown: Weighing the Costs of a Relaunch

In its final announcement on October 23, the Bunni team provided a transparent assessment of why they chose closure over revival. The path to a secure relaunch was deemed prohibitively expensive and time-consuming. The team estimated that it would require "six to seven figures" in capital solely for new, comprehensive audits and ongoing monitoring services.

Furthermore, they projected that months of redevelopment would be necessary to rewrite and secure the protocol's core components. For a project whose treasury had been decimated and whose community trust was shattered, procuring such significant resources was an insurmountable challenge. User Compensation and Open-Source Legacy

As part of its responsible shutdown process, Bunni has outlined clear steps for its users and token holders. Firstly, users are able to withdraw their remaining assets directly through the Bunni website for the foreseeable future.

Secondly, the project has committed to distributing its remaining treasury assets to BUNNI, LIT, and veBUNNI token holders. This distribution will be based on a snapshot taken at an unspecified time and will commence once the legal process surrounding the exploit is concluded. The team has explicitly stated that its members will be excluded from this final distribution, a move aimed at ensuring fairness for the community.

In a final act that underscores its commitment to DeFi innovation, Bunni has relicensed its v2 smart contracts from the Business Source License (BUSL) to the permissive MIT license. This makes its core technologies—including the Liquidity Distribution Functions (LDFs), surge fees, and autonomous rebalancing features—freely available for any developer to use, study, and build upon. The team also confirmed that they continue to work with law enforcement agencies in an effort to recover the stolen funds.

Broader Context: DeFi Security in 2025

The shutdown of Bunni contributes to an alarming trend in blockchain security. According to data referenced in the project's closure statement, over $3.1 billion has been lost to hacks and exploits so far in 2025 alone. This figure places immense pressure on the entire DeFi industry to prioritize security without stifling innovation.

While other major exploits have occurred on different types of protocols—such as cross-chain bridges and lending platforms—the Bunni case is a stark reminder that even audited, non-custodial exchanges built on established frameworks like Uniswap V4 are not immune. It highlights that as DeFi protocols become more complex in their quest for efficiency and yield optimization, their attack surface also expands, requiring an ever-higher standard of security rigor.
